Vietnam's largest irrigation lake releases water for a week, risking flooding of houses along Saigon River

TPO - Dau Tieng Lake has been releasing water through the spillway for more than a week, and authorities have warned that if accompanied by rain, there is a risk of flooding in areas along the Saigon River. The Steering Committee for Natural Disaster Prevention and Control - Search and Rescue of Binh Duong province has requested relevant units and localities to proactively monitor and promptly respond.
On September 24, the Standing Office of the Steering Committee for Natural Disaster Prevention and Control - Search and Rescue of Binh Duong province announced the first water discharge through the spillway of Dau Tieng reservoir in 2024. Accordingly, the spillway discharge period starts from September 24 to October 1. The discharge flow through the spillway is 100 m3/s with a total discharge volume of 60.48 million m3. According to the authorities, the discharge flow of 100 m3/s is aimed at proactively preventing floods for works and downstream areas, and under normal conditions does not cause flooding in communes and wards along the Saigon River. However, the announcement stated that it is necessary to be cautious when heavy rain combined with the above spillway discharge can cause local flooding in low-lying areas along the Saigon River. The Standing Office of the Steering Committee for Natural Disaster Prevention - Search and Rescue of Binh Duong province informs the Steering Committee for Natural Disaster Prevention - Search and Rescue of Dau Tieng district, Ben Cat city, Thuan An city, Thu Dau Mot city and the Center for Investment, Exploitation of Irrigation and Rural Clean Water to proactively respond. Previously, many times, houses of people in the areas along the Saigon River in Thuan An city, Dau Tieng district (Binh Duong) were flooded due to heavy rains and the discharge of floodwater from Dau Tieng lake.

With a surface area of about 270 km2, Dau Tieng Lake is the largest irrigation lake in Vietnam, located in the three provinces of Tay Ninh, Binh Duong and Binh Phuoc . In addition to regulating water to the Saigon River, the lake also serves irrigation for agricultural production in the provinces of the Southeast region.
